In 1956 a number of skeletons were discovered N of Mobhi Lane and E of the Church of Ireland, Glasnevin. These were not oriented in the same direction, one was N-S and another was NW-SE. Animal bones were found on site. An iron knife was also found (NMI 1960:16).
